在开发区块链应用时,tpWallet作为一种流行的钱包解决方案,常常被开发者选择。然而,在使用 tpWallet 进行应用打包时,偶尔会遇到打包失败的问题。本文将详细介绍如何排查和解决 tpWallet 打包失败的问题,帮助你顺利完成项目。
在使用 tpWallet 打包时,打包失败的原因复杂多样。以下是一些常见的原因。
1. 环境配置错误:确保开发环境中的所有依赖、库文件及配置均正确。
2. 代码错误:检查代码中是否存在编译错误,比如语法错误、缺失的模块等。
3. 资源文件格式不正确:确保所有资源文件符合 tpWallet 的要求,如图片尺寸和文件类型。
4. 版本不匹配:tpWallet及其依赖库的版本不兼容,需确保使用正确版本。
一旦确认了导致打包失败的原因,我们可以针对性地采取措施。
1. 检查环境配置:确保安装正确的工具链和依赖包,使用官网推荐的版本。
2. 修正代码错误:利用开发环境中的调试工具逐行检查,并修正发现的问题。
3. 处理资源文件:使用正确的工具处理图片和音频文件,确保符合要求。
4. 升级或降级版本:根据官方文档指导,更新到推荐版本,并进行兼容性测试。
在打包 tpWallet 时,确实需要符合特定的系统要求。通常,Windows、macOS 和 Linux 系统都能支持 tpWallet 的打包过程。但具体的环境版本、依赖的工具和库可能会因为版本不同而有所差异,开发者应根据官方文档进行安装与配置。
是的,tpWallet 在打包过程中会生成相关的日志文件,这些日志文件提供了详细的错误信息。开发者可以查看日志,查找打包失败的具体原因。通常情况下,日志信息会指出出错的模块和行号,这将极大地方便问题的排查与解决。
为了降低打包失败的几率,开发者可以采取以下预防措施。首先,保持环境的干净和有序,定期更新开发工具和库。其次,保持代码的最佳实践,定期进行单元测试,避免出现大规模的错误。最后,添加清晰的注释和文档,使团队成员在协作时更易于理解和解决问题。
当开发者在解决 tpWallet 打包失败时遇到困难,可以向社区、官方支持或专业论坛寻求帮助。很多时候,其他开发者可能遇到过类似问题,他们的经验可能会为你提供解决方案。同时,详细描述所遇到的问题以及提供相关截图和日志信息,会更有助于他人在了解情况后提供帮助。
tpWallet 打包失败并不是罕见的现象,但多数情况下都可以通过系统性的方法找到解决方案。希望本文能为你提供有价值的指导,助力你顺利打包并实现项目目标。
这只是一个大致的结构和内容框架,你可以根据具体需要进行扩展和调整。